aboutsummaryrefslogtreecommitdiff
path: root/nix/mkHomeManagerConfiguration.nix
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--nix/mkHomeManagerConfiguration.nix10
1 files changed, 8 insertions, 2 deletions
diff --git a/nix/mkHomeManagerConfiguration.nix b/nix/mkHomeManagerConfiguration.nix
index bcf374a..70e875d 100644
--- a/nix/mkHomeManagerConfiguration.nix
+++ b/nix/mkHomeManagerConfiguration.nix
@@ -3,9 +3,11 @@ inputs@{ self, ... }:
, username ? "fcuny"
, hostname
, stateVersion ? "22.05"
-, extraModules ? [ ]
,
}:
+let
+ naersk = inputs.naersk.lib."${system}";
+in
inputs.home-manager.lib.homeManagerConfiguration {
inherit system;
inherit username;
@@ -19,8 +21,12 @@ inputs.home-manager.lib.homeManagerConfiguration {
overlays = [
inputs.emacs-overlay.overlay
inputs.nur.overlay
+ inputs.naersk.overlay
inputs.rust.overlays.default
- (final: prev: { tools = import "${self}/tools" { pkgs = prev; }; })
+ (final: prev:
+ {
+ tools = import "${self}/tools" { pkgs = prev; inherit naersk; };
+ })
];
};
configuration.imports =